A 15 hour documentary, made over 5 years
filmed in America, all over Europe, Africa, Japan, India, China, South America, Russia, and Australia. In the great movie studios and cinema museums of the world – Tokyo, LA, Torino, Kolkata, Paris, etc
Participants: Wim Wenders, Baz Luhrmann, Jane Campion, Abbas Kiarostami, Amitabh Bachchan, Stanley Donen, Maggie Cheung, Buck Henry, Tilda Swinton, Kyoko Kagawa who acted for Kurosawa, Ozu and Mizoguchi; Yuen Woo-ping (The Matrix and Crouching Tiger); Youssef Chahine (the first great African filmmaker, the first great Arab filmmaker); Amitabh Bachchan, Sharmila Tagore (the muse of Satyajit Ray); Paul Schrader, Robert Towne, Gus Van Sant.
This is a history of innovation of the medium, not showbiz or money.
Directed by Mark Cousins
